About This Item

New York: Oxford University Press, 1999. 1st. Hardcover. Near Fine/Near Fine. Hardcover, 242 pages. B&w and color prints. Lavishly illustrated catalog presenting a fascinating cultural history of an idyllic vision of California that still figures prominently in the American imagination. Red cloth, gilt lettering to spine. Pictorial dust jacket. Copy in mint condition, looks brand new. Record # 605200
